GREENVILLE, Pa. – The Thiel College women's basketball team lost a Presidents' Athletic Conference (PAC) game to the Geneva Golden Tornadoes Wednesday at Beeghly Gymnasium, 95-58.
Rachel Breckenridge (Burton, Ohio/Berkshire) scored a game-high 18 points for the Tomcats while also contributing four rebounds, two assists and a steal. Breckenridge made 5-of-15 shots from the floor and went 3-of-10 from behind the three-point line. She also made all five of her shots from the free-throw line.
Destiny Johnson (Baltimore, Md./Western) corralled a game-best 11 rebounds. She also scored seven points while recording four assists, three steals and two blocks.
